Okay, so I recently got my hands on the JUNGSAEMMOOL Artist Drawing Shadow Pencil in three shades, and let me tell you, these little guys are a game-changer for my everyday makeup routine. As someone who loves a good eye look but doesn't always have a ton of time, these pencils are perfect. The texture is super smooth, almost creamy, which makes them incredibly easy to apply. No tugging or skipping, which is a huge plus, especially when I'm in a rush in the morning. I've been using them as a base for my eyeshadows, and it really makes the colors pop and last way longer. Plus, they don't crease! I've tried other cream shadow sticks before, and they always end up settling into my eyelid creases after a few hours. But these? They stay put, even on a humid day in Seoul.
I've been reaching for the shades 'Muted Rose' and 'Warm Beige' the most. 'Muted Rose' is this beautiful, soft pinky-brown that's perfect for a subtle, romantic look. It adds just enough color to make my eyes look awake and polished without being over the top. I can wear this to work, and it looks totally natural.
'Warm Beige' is my go-to for a quick, no-makeup makeup look. It’s a lovely neutral shade that brightens up my eyes and makes them look bigger. I often just swipe this all over my lid and blend it out with my finger, and I'm good to go. It’s like a magic wand for tired eyes!
The third shade I have is a bit bolder, and I've been experimenting with it for evening looks. It's fantastic for creating a smoky eye effect because it blends out so easily. You can build up the intensity gradually, which is great for controlling the look.
What I really appreciate is how versatile they are. You can use them as a full lid shadow, an eyeliner, or even a subtle highlighter in the inner corner of your eye. The pencil format makes it super precise, so you don't need a separate brush for detailed work.
Honestly, these have become a staple in my makeup bag. They are long-wearing, easy to use, and deliver beautiful, blendable color.
